All India Majlis-e-Ittehadul Muslimeen (AIMIM) chief Asaduddin Owaisi has accepted the victory of the Bharatiya Janata Party (BJP) in UP as a public order. He also rejected the allegations of EVM rigging while respecting the public’s decision. However, he said that people have a special chip in their mind. Owaisi said about the poor performance of his party that the result has not been as expected.
Speaking to ANI, Owaisi said, “People have decided to give power to BJP. I welcome the decision of the people. I express my gratitude to the AIMIM state chief, workers, members and the people of the state who voted for us. We tried a lot, but the results did not come as per our expectations. We will work hard again.”

AIMIM chief Asaduddin Owaisi rubbished the issue of EVMs being raised by the SP and said, “All political parties want to raise the issue of EVMs to hide their defeat. There is nothing wrong with EVMs, there is a chip in the mind of the people. It is a success, but it is 80:20. “We will start working again from tomorrow and hope to do better next time,” he said.
